Vermont 1908 Presidential Election
Democratic Candidate vs. Republican Candidate
Republican Candidate won the Vermont 1908 presidential election with 39,552 votes (75.1%), a margin of R+53.3. Vermont's 3 electoral votes went to the Republican ticket.
